Digital Marketing for Jewellery & Luxury Goods: How Brand Storytelling, Influencer Collaborations, and Premium Customer Engagement Drive Growth

Views: 4
Read Time:6 Minute, 22 Second

Luxury jewellery has always been about more than beautiful designs and precious gemstones. Every piece tells a story of love, celebration, achievement, or tradition. While exceptional craftsmanship remains the hallmark of luxury brands, the way people discover and interact with these brands has changed significantly in the digital age.

Today, most customers begin their buying journey online. They browse Instagram for inspiration, watch influencer videos, read customer reviews, and visit brand websites before they ever walk into a showroom. Because of this shift in consumer behavior, digital marketing has become an essential part of building a successful jewellery and luxury brand. It is no longer just about displaying products; it’s about creating meaningful connections that inspire trust and loyalty.

Why Digital Marketing Has Become Essential

Luxury jewellery is often purchased to celebrate life’s biggest milestones, from engagements and weddings to anniversaries and personal achievements. These purchases are emotional, which means customers want to feel connected to the brand behind the product.

Digital marketing gives jewellery brands the opportunity to create that connection. Through engaging content, personalized communication, and authentic interactions, brands can stay connected with customers throughout their buying journey, making every experience feel memorable rather than transactional.

Storytelling Adds Value Beyond the Product

Every jewellery brand has something unique to share. It could be a family legacy, a commitment to fine craftsmanship, or the inspiration behind a signature collection. Sharing these stories helps customers understand what makes the brand different.

Instead of only promoting a diamond’s brilliance or a necklace’s design, successful brands showcase the people and passion behind every creation. They introduce customers to skilled artisans, explain the creative process, and highlight the traditions that have shaped their collections.

These stories create an emotional bond, making every piece of jewellery feel more meaningful. Customers are far more likely to remember a brand that makes them feel something than one that simply displays beautiful products.

Building Trust Through Transparency

Today’s luxury buyers like to know exactly what they are investing in. They often research brands before making a purchase and appreciate companies that are open about their values and practices.

Many jewellery brands are strengthening customer trust by sharing information about:

  • Their craftsmanship and design process
  • Ethical sourcing of diamonds and gemstones
  • Sustainable manufacturing practices
  • The history and heritage of the brand
  • The inspiration behind each collection

When brands communicate openly and honestly, customers feel more confident about their purchase and are more likely to become loyal supporters.

Influencer Collaborations That Feel Authentic

Influencer marketing has become an important part of digital marketing for luxury brands. Instead of depending only on celebrity endorsements, many jewellery companies now work with fashion influencers, bridal creators, luxury lifestyle bloggers, and content creators whose audiences genuinely trust their opinions.

The best collaborations don’t feel like advertisements. They tell real stories—a bride sharing her wedding jewellery, a creator celebrating a personal milestone, or someone styling a favourite piece for a special occasion.

This kind of content feels natural and relatable, helping potential customers imagine how the jewellery fits into their own lives.

Choosing the Right Influencers

For luxury brands, the quality of an influencer partnership is far more important than the number of followers.

Successful collaborations usually involve creators who:

  • Share values similar to the brand
  • Produce elegant and professional content
  • Have an engaged and loyal audience
  • Present products naturally
  • Have built credibility with their followers

A recommendation from someone people genuinely trust often delivers better results than a campaign focused only on reach.

Social Media Has Become a Digital Showroom

Platforms like Instagram, Pinterest, YouTube, and Facebook have become virtual showrooms where customers discover new collections and interact with luxury brands.

Jewellery companies use social media to share:

  • Behind-the-scenes craftsmanship
  • Product launches
  • Styling inspiration
  • Customer stories
  • Designer interviews
  • Event highlights
  • Limited-edition collections
  • Short videos showcasing intricate details

Consistent, visually appealing content helps reinforce a luxury brand’s identity while encouraging customers to explore its products.

Creating Premium Customer Experiences Online

Luxury customers expect an exceptional experience whether they shop in-store or online.

To meet these expectations, many jewellery brands now offer digital services such as:

  • Virtual consultations with jewellery specialists
  • Personalized product recommendations
  • Online appointment booking
  • Virtual try-on technology
  • Live product demonstrations
  • Exclusive previews of new collections

These services make online shopping more convenient while maintaining the personalized experience customers expect from luxury brands.

Customer Relationships Continue Beyond the Sale

Luxury brands understand that building customer loyalty doesn’t end once a purchase is completed.

Many jewellers continue engaging customers through after-sales services such as jewellery cleaning, maintenance, repairs, resizing, authenticity certificates, and dedicated customer support. They also stay connected through anniversary greetings, exclusive invitations, loyalty rewards, and early access to new collections.

These thoughtful interactions make customers feel valued and encourage them to return for future purchases.

Personalization Makes Every Customer Feel Special

Luxury is personal, and customers appreciate brands that recognize their preferences.

Instead of sending identical promotions to every customer, successful brands use purchase history and browsing behavior to offer personalized recommendations. Someone who recently purchased bridal jewellery might receive anniversary gift suggestions, while another customer could be invited to preview a limited-edition collection.

This level of personalization creates stronger relationships and makes every interaction more meaningful.

Content Marketing Builds Authority

Useful and informative content helps jewellery brands establish themselves as trusted experts while improving their online visibility.

Many brands publish articles and videos on topics such as:

  • Choosing the perfect engagement ring
  • Jewellery care and maintenance
  • Diamond buying guides
  • Styling jewellery for different occasions
  • Seasonal fashion trends
  • Gift ideas for special celebrations
  • Sustainable luxury jewellery

Providing valuable information helps customers make informed decisions while strengthening the brand’s reputation.

SEO Helps Customers Find Luxury Brands Online

A beautifully designed website has little value if potential customers cannot find it.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) helps jewellery brands appear in search results when people look for luxury jewellery, engagement rings, diamond necklaces, or related information. Optimized product pages, informative blog articles, fast-loading websites, and mobile-friendly designs all contribute to better search visibility.

An effective SEO strategy attracts visitors who are actively searching for luxury products, increasing the chances of generating qualified leads and sales.

Technology Is Enhancing the Luxury Experience

Technology continues to reshape how customers shop for luxury jewellery.

Artificial intelligence helps brands recommend products based on customer preferences, while augmented reality allows shoppers to virtually try on rings, earrings, or necklaces before making a purchase. Virtual consultations and interactive online showrooms further enhance convenience without compromising the premium experience.

Rather than replacing personal service, technology makes luxury shopping more accessible and engaging.

Looking Ahead

The future of digital marketing in the jewellery and luxury goods industry lies in combining timeless craftsmanship with modern customer expectations. Consumers are looking for brands that are authentic, transparent, and customer-focused.

Businesses that invest in storytelling, meaningful influencer partnerships, personalized customer engagement, quality content, and SEO will be better positioned to build lasting relationships in an increasingly competitive market.

As technology continues to evolve, the brands that successfully balance innovation with tradition will remain at the forefront of the luxury industry.

Conclusion

Digital marketing has become one of the most powerful tools for jewellery and luxury brands looking to grow in today’s competitive marketplace. While exceptional products remain the foundation of success, meaningful storytelling, authentic influencer collaborations, personalized customer experiences, and a strong online presence are what truly set successful brands apart.

Customers don’t simply buy luxury jewellery—they invest in memories, emotions, and experiences. Brands that understand this and create genuine connections through digital marketing will earn lasting trust, stronger customer loyalty, and sustainable business growth for years to come.
